Output d24da75a2e0e25bdebf2cabd7e37f434f2cd27ddccf378fa3b5b4ff671ddc05d:0

value
903683269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f5c7bbe77afb1ec3bf2316e0df5f5efcc4ad569 OP_EQUAL
address
3BqqihEVRbYerTLZNVkKD7eAwsYtvSBh67
transaction
d24da75a2e0e25bdebf2cabd7e37f434f2cd27ddccf378fa3b5b4ff671ddc05d
confirmations
385516
spent
true